Surface area Preparation
Prior to repainting your home, make sure to extensively prepare the surfaces by cleaning and repairing any type of flaws. Begin by washing the walls with a light detergent solution to eliminate dirt, dust, and grease. Utilize a sponge or fabric to scrub gently, ensuring all surface areas are tidy and dry before proceeding.
Inspect the walls for any type of splits, openings, or peeling paint. Fill in any type of spaces with spackling substance, sanding it smooth once dry. For bigger openings, take into consideration using a spot set for a seamless finish.
Next off, very carefully inspect the trim, walls, and crown molding. Clean them down with a moist fabric to eliminate any type of grime or deposit. Look for any dents or scratches that need to be filled up and fined sand.
Do not forget the ceilings-- tidy them completely and deal with any type of imperfections before paint.
Shade and Complete Option
To achieve the desired aesthetic for your home, carefully choose the colors and finishes that will certainly boost the general look and feel of each space. When picking colors, take into consideration the state of mind you want to produce in each space. Lighter shades can make an area feel more sizable and airy, while darker tones can include heat and comfort. Consider the all-natural light that goes into the room and how it may influence the shade throughout the day.
Along with shade, the finish of the paint is likewise critical. Matte coatings can hide blemishes however might be more difficult to clean up, while satin and semi-gloss finishes are a lot more sturdy and cleanable. Shiny coatings can include a touch of elegance but might highlight imperfections in the wall surfaces.
Remember that different spaces may take advantage of different color pattern and finishes based on their feature and the ambience you wish to produce.
Put in the time to evaluate tiny patches of paint on the wall surfaces to see exactly how they search in different lights problems prior to making your final decision.
Furniture and Decor Security
Think about covering your furnishings and design products to safeguard them from paint splatters and drips during the expert paint process. Use plastic ground cloth or old bedsheets to protect your valuables from unintentional spills.
Relocate furniture to the center of the area or into one more location far from the walls being repainted. If relocating large items isn't possible, group them with each other and cover with safety products.
For smaller sized decor items, eliminate them from the space entirely if feasible. If removing them isn't a choice, carefully cover them in plastic or towel to prevent paint damage.
Pay special attention to electronic devices and valuable items that could be easily wrecked by paint.
